“We might damage the image Fin.K.L. used to have.”
That’s what Kpop singer and musical actress Ock Joo-hyun had to say when asked about the possibility of a reunion of the pop group Fin.K.L. The former members of Fin.K.L. are Lee Hyori, Lee Jin, Sung Yuri and Ock Joo-hyun.
In an interview with Sportsworld on June 6, Ock Joohyun said, “All the former members of Fin.K.L. are successfully building their own careers in their respective fields. After we went our seperate ways, we haven’t worked as Fin.K.L. for quite a long time, so there will be too many things for us to prepare, so realistically , that is impossible.”
When asked whether there will be a possibility for Fin.K.L. to have a special concert to celebrate their tenth anniversary this year, Ock added: “We might damage the reputation and image fans used to have and remember of Fin.K.L.”
The pop diva however said she is very grateful during the time she has worked and stayed as a member of Fin.K.L.
She concluded: “We (Fin.K.L. members) cannot forget how grateful we are to those who helped us in so many ways when we were a part of Fin.K.L. because we cannot deny that we are all ‘Made in Fin.K.L.’”

The group did make a brief comeback at the end of 2005, as they released a digital single titled Fine Killing Liberty that had 4 songs (including the title track) and a music video. However, due to lack of promotion (as the group did not perform on the various music shows), the single failed to chart. Instead of ignoring the single, though, they have since released a special Fin.K.L. Forever set that had two DVDs (one with their music videos and the other with various performances) and a photobook that also had the Fine Killing Liberty single in CD form.
Ock Joo-hyun has just released her third solo album ‘Remind’ on the 13th and the first single of her song is titled ‘Honey’.
